Nextcloud私有云文件系统在Docker上的部署和使用
发布网友
发布时间:2024-10-08 17:07
我来回答
共1个回答
热心网友
时间:2024-11-10 15:06
Nextcloud是一个功能丰富的开源云存储平台,提供文件存储、聊天通信、办公协作和日历分享等服务。它支持多种设备访问,如网页端和Android、iOS、Windows、Mac、Linux等。
要部署Nextcloud到Docker,首先下载NextCloud文件服务管理系统的镜像,当下载完成时,会显示类似输出。接着,下载并创建PostgreSQL数据库镜像用于数据存储。在终端中,创建NextCloud的配置和数据目录,并编写启动脚本。在nextcloud目录下,编辑docker-compose.yml文件,将配置路径改为实际的data目录路径。
启动命令执行后,通过浏览器访问服务器IP地址(例如192.168.59.128:8000)初始化Nextcloud,创建管理员账户和配置数据库,这里推荐使用PostgreSQL。数据目录保持默认,填写相应的数据库信息后,点击安装开始初始化。
安装完成后,进入主界面,注意避免在系统管理页面进行不必要的升级。手机与电脑的同步要求在同一局域网。登录Nextcloud客户端,可以在官网下载对应平台的安装包,Windows从官方下载,iOS在App Store搜索,安卓则在谷歌商店或F-droid获取。
电脑端登录时,使用部署后访问的地址,授权登录后选择同步本地目录或直接连接。登录成功后,桌面端右下角会显示Nextcloud图标,同步进行中会有相应的图标指示。